Course Overview

After a short theoretical overview of how GPS works, the majority of the course is spent practicing hands-on navigational exercises to develop your skills with GPS functions and capabilities. You can expect to learn all the features of your GPS and their on-the-water applications. Come away with increased facility to use your own GPS in the classroom and subsequently under pressure at sea.

Topics

  • GPS overview
  • Creating, installing and storing waypoints
  • Navigating to a waypoint
  • Creating and storing routes
  • Using GPS tracking
  • Setting waypoint alerts
  • Anchoring alerts
  • Tailored settings for your particular boating needs
  • GPS chart-plotting latitude and longitude
  • Tips on buying your new GPS receiver
